First book of Vonnegut's I've finished. You can really tell he's been trying to unclog that pipe for a while (he says so in the prologue). His view of American humanity is both a wide lens yet steeped in underfoot ugliness. I can't say I enjoyed the commentary on racism but overall it was a provoking read. A little like being fed eight experimental meals at once. Would recommend.
